Tutoring & Learning - Work in the Centers

Employment at TLC
At the Learning Center, we offer employment opportunities to students, former students and members of the community. There are three ways you can get involved at the Learning Center.

Tutors
Would you like to:

  • Help students who are struggling with concepts or processes in certain academic subjects?
  • Help students who simply want to strengthen their knowledge?
  • Become eligible for certification from the National Tutoring Association?

Are you willing to:

  • Attend training sessions and follow established procedures to become nationally certified as a tutor?
  • Attend tutor meetings?
  • Be responsible, reliable, patient and attuned to the needs of tutees?

Tutors typically specialize in a few subjects about which they feel the most knowledgeable. If you are interested in tutoring, please fill out this application and submit it with accompanying documents to TLC in room 609.

Apprentice Tutors
Apprentice tutors are volunteers (usually first-year students at PVCC) who shadow an experienced tutor for one semester. After going through training and attending tutor meetings, apprentices become tutors themselves in their second semester, at which point they receive the hourly tutoring wage. High-achieving, enthusiastic recent high school graduates are encouraged to apply, as it is always important to become an active part of your College's community! If you'd like to be an apprentice, please fill out this application.

Academic Coaches
Academic coaches are similar to tutors in that they help students to do well in their studies. An academic coach is really a tutor in the "how to be a good student" subject. Coaches must have all the qualities of a tutor along with the ability to pinpoint a student's individual learning style and lifestyle pattern. Coaches help students find what reading, writing, note taking, studying and test taking strategies work best for them.
